Garden upkeep is an important practice for keeping outside areas healthy, lively, and welcoming throughout the year. A properly maintained garden not just enhances a residential or commercial property's visual appeal however also guarantees the durability of its plants and functions. Maintenance involves routine tasks such as pruning, deadheading, weeding, watering, and soil care. By resolving these requirements regularly, gardeners can avoid pest infestations, control disease spread, and maintain a well balanced environment where plants grow. Seasonal considerations, such as mulching in the spring or safeguarding fragile plants in winter season, are also crucial to sustaining garden vitality. Beyond looks, proper garden upkeep plays a role in supporting plant health and biodiversity. Eliminating unhealthy or damaged foliage assists prevent pathogens from dispersing, while tactical pruning encourages new development and flowering. Soil conditioning-- through composting, aeration, and organic matter replenishment-- provides the nutrients plants need to grow. In addition, the thoughtful combination of buddy planting and pollinator-friendly types can improve garden resilience while adding to regional communities. A structured maintenance schedule assists house owners prepare for ongoing needs and prevent costly overhauls later. This schedule frequently includes regular monthly examinations, seasonal clean-ups, and targeted treatments as needed. Whether for decorative flower beds, vegetable plots, or mixed-use landscapes, consistent care ensures that the garden remains a source of enjoyment and appeal all year long
